Denounces the energy and federal land policies of the Biden Administration.
Official title: Denouncing the harmful, anti-American energy policies of the Biden administration, and for other purposes.
This bill died when its Congress ended.
Bills don't carry over between Congresses. Without re-introduction in a new session, it cannot advance.
This House resolution expresses opposition to the Biden administration's energy and federal land policies. It encourages increased domestic production of reliable and affordable energy sources. The resolution has no direct legal effect—it is a statement of the House's position.
- Denounce Biden administration's energy and federal land management policies
- Encourage domestic production of reliable and affordable energy sources
- Express House position through nonbinding resolution without legal force
This resolution has been adopted by the House. As a simple resolution, it did not need the other chamber's approval or the President's signature — so it's complete.
